Lionel Messi Under Scrutiny After Egypt Coach Triggers Anti-Racism Protocol

Argentina's dramatic 3-2 victory over Egypt in the FIFA World Cup Round of 16 has been marred by controversy after an on-field exchange between Lionel Messi and Egypt head coach Hossam Hassan led to the activation of FIFA's anti-racism protocol. The incident occurred during the tense closing phase of the match, which saw Argentina come back from a 2-0 deficit to win with a stoppage-time goal.

Hossam Hassan, the Egypt coach, made FIFA's official anti-racism gesture towards referee Francois Letexier after an exchange with Messi on the sidelines. The referee acknowledged the signal and briefly activated the anti-racism protocol before showing Hassan a yellow card. FIFA has not yet confirmed the exact nature of the incident or whether any disciplinary action will follow.

The match itself was filled with twists and turns, with Egypt taking a 2-0 lead before Argentina mounted a sensational comeback. Messi played a key role in the turnaround, despite missing a penalty earlier in the game. Argentina scored three unanswered goals, including a dramatic stoppage-time winner, to book their place in the quarter-finals.

Following the defeat, Hassan launched a scathing attack on the officiating, claiming Egypt had been denied a legitimate goal after a VAR review and were also refused a penalty late in the match. The veteran coach described the refereeing decisions as unfair and suggested they had a decisive impact on the outcome of the Round of 16 clash.
